Position Summary: Summit Handling Systems is seeking a
detail-oriented and process-driven Accounting Specialist to join
our Finance team. This role is responsible for high-volume invoice
processing, vendor account management, payment execution, and
supporting month-end close activities. Responsibilities: Accounts
Payable Accurately enter, code, and match purchase orders, packing
slips, and vendor invoices. Process high-volume invoices across
multiple states, branches and departments. Execute payments via
ACH, check, and credit card in accordance with vendor terms.
Prepare weekly check runs and ACH batches. Maintain vendor records
including W-9s, payment terms, and onboarding documentation. Manage
daily Positive Pay submissions and resolve banking exceptions.
Reconcile bank transactions related to disbursements and confirm
ACH activity. Prepare AP aging reports and support month-end
accruals and reconciliations. Support internal and external audits
as needed. Accounts Receivable Support Prepare daily check
deposits. Process and code daily receipts. Assist with AR-related
bank reconciliations and statement review. Support credit card
reconciliation and documentation. Qualifications: Associate’s
degree in Accounting, Business Administration, or related field
preferred. 4–5 years of experience in high-volume Accounts Payable.
Experience with Positive Pay and banking portals. Proficiency in
accounting systems and Microsoft Excel. ERP experience preferred
(e.g., Microsoft Dynamics, NetSuite, SAP). Strong attention to
